# Set system property to define fiscal period

# Set the fiscal period property for TCO dashboards {#ariaid-title1}

Set the system property (com.glide.fiscal_calendar.fiscal_unit) to view TCO dashboards for a specific duration of the fiscal period in the Dashboard page of the Enterprise Architecture
Workspace.

## Before you begin

Role required: admin

## Procedure

1. Navigate to AllSystem PropertiesAll Properties.
2. Search and open the com.glide.fiscal_calendar.fiscal_unit property.
3. Update the Value field according to your requirement.  
   You can update the value to Quarter or Month or Week.
4. Select  Update.  
   The Portfolio TCO dashboard page shows the data according to the specified duration of the fiscal period.
